The Miami Hurricanes scored a major victory on Saturday, three days after missing out on a cornerback target. Four-star prospect Jaboree Antoine, a cornerback from Louisiana, committed nonbindingly to UM, choosing it over LSU and FSU.

Antoine is ranked No. 71 overall and No. 8 among cornerbacks in this class by 247 Sports. He is ranked No. 87 prospect and No. 9 cornerback by On.3. About 72 hours have passed since five-star cornerback DJ Pickett chose LSU over Oregon and UM. Before telling UM on Friday that he would be joining the Hurricanes, Antoine, a student at Westlake High in Iberia, Louisiana, de-committed from LSU in June but was thought to have recommitted to the Tigers. Antoine stated on social media and on On.3’s announcement show on Saturday that “really it came down to a late decision.”

“I just had a lot of questions that needed to be answered. UM was really unmatched.” “They’re getting a leader on and off the field,” he added of the Canes. We are going to try to win a national title, and you are receiving a corner that can take away one half of the field. Antoine noted that “everyone on the [UM] staff was excited” when he announced his commitment.

Antoine has visited UM twice, the most recent visit occurring on May 31. “I’m prepared to go outside at this moment.” Due to a collarbone injury, Antoine only made five appearances in the previous season. He had 32 tackles, 11 pass breakups, and five interceptions in 2022. In 2022, he also saw action at quarterback, finishing 105 of 186 throw attempts with 1,650 yards and 12 touchdowns. Antoine, a 6-1,

180-pound prospect, is UM’s 2025 cornerback commitment, along with three-star Timothy Merritt and four-star prospect Chris Ewald Jr. Another UM commit, Amari Wallace is a four-star prospect who can play safety or cornerback. The Canes are still in the running for a number of other highly regarded defensive backs, though: ▪ Bryce Fitzgerald, a four-star safety for Miami Columbus,

is anticipated to make an announcement in mid-August. FSU and UF are also fierce rivals. ▪ Cornerback Ben Hanks Jr. of Booker T. Washington, who is ranked No. 81 overall and No. 10 among cornerbacks. He’s thinking of Louisville, UF, FSU, UM, and UF. UF is now the front-runner according to On3.com. Three-star recruit Aiden Anding, a Louisiana native, is ranked No. 38 among corners by 247 Sports. Included in the mix are Texas, TCU, LSU, and Arkansas. Vernell Brown III, a four-star 2025 receiver out of Orlando (Fla.) Jones, is one of UM’s offensive targets. He is anticipated to select between UM, FSU, UF, and Ohio State on Sunday. Now, the Canes have committed 19 players for the Class of 2025, 13 of whom have come from four-star prospects since June 1. UM’s class is ranked eighth in the nation by 247 Sports.
